Dear John:
We have the MCP-TAFA metal spray system of HEK Germany. The system
consists of an arc spray gun No. 8850, spray booth TCa-1000, MCP 400
metal wire, fresh air helmet, release agent set, steel fillers,
Al fillers, epoxy EP-180 and release agent set.
We are using this system for coating patterns of foundry, metal
coating epoxy molds and metal coating FDM RP models. The metal coating
can vary from 1 mm to 2 mm. The metal spray is classified as cold
metal spray.
Mr. V Sridharan has just finished his Master's thesis using this system.
He studied the effects of metal spray on epoxy molds in terms
of incresing their strength and quality.
